There are numerous islands and islets located surrounding the main island of Singapore. Apart from Sentosa Island, which has been turned into a major recreational destination, many of these islands remain uninhabited. Some of these are the site of major industries such as petroleum refinery and shipyards. Such islands are off limits to all except authorized personnel.
On this page I list out the natural as well as man-made islands surrounding Singapore with the information that I have gathered about each of them. Also listed here are former islands that have since been connected to the Singapore mainland.
Land reclamation is an on-going process in Singapore, resulting in the expansion of land area on both the main island of Singapore as well as many of its outlying islands.

Former Islands
- Anak Pulau - island that is now part of Jurong Island
- Berhala Reping - island that is now part of Sentosa
- Pulau Ayer Chawan - island that is now part of Jurong Island
- Pulau Ayer Merbau - island that is now part of Jurong Island
- Pulau Bakau - island that is now part of Jurong Island
- Pulau Darat - island that is now part of Sentosa
- Pulau Merlimau - island that is now part of Jurong Island
- Pulau Mesemut Darat - island that is now part of Jurong Island
- Pulau Mesemut Laut - island that is now part of Jurong Island
- Pulau Meskol - island that is now part of Jurong Island
- Pulau Pesek - island that is now part of Jurong Island
- Pulau Pesek Kecil - island that is now part of Jurong Island
- Pulau Saigon - island along Singapore River
- Pulau Sakeng/Pulau Seking - island that is now part of Pulau Semakau
- Pulau Sakra - island that is now part of Jurong Island
- Pulau Sanyongkong - island that is now part of Pulau Tekong
- Pulau Sejahat - island that is now part of Pulau Tekong
- Pulau Sejahat Kechil - island that is now part of Pulau Tekong
- Pulau Semechek - island that is now part of Pulau Tekong
- Pulau Seraya - island that is now part of Jurong Island
- Pulau Tekong Kechil - island that is now part of Pulau Tekong
- Terumbu Retan Laut - island that is now part of Pasir Panjang Container Terminal of the main island.
